What is the Pulse Oximetry Testing Service Order Form?
The Pulse Oximetry Testing Service Order Form is a specialized document utilized in healthcare to formally request pulse oximetry testing services. It plays a critical role in ensuring that testing is compliant with medical standards and insurance requirements, particularly in Ohio. This form captures essential patient information, diagnosis codes, and requires a physician’s signature, facilitating a smooth process for both healthcare providers and insurance entities.

What are the eligibility requirements for using the Pulse Oximetry Testing Service Order Form?
Typically, any physician licensed in Ohio can use this form to request pulse oximetry testing for their patients. Patients must also meet clinical indications as determined by their healthcare provider.
Is there a deadline for submitting the completed Pulse Oximetry Testing Service Order Form?
While there may not be a strict deadline, it is advisable to submit the form as soon as possible to ensure timely processing of testing services and insurance claims.
